Judge: medium-light skin tone Emoji

People

A person with a medium-light skin tone wearing a black judicial robe and a white collar. They are shown holding a wooden gavel, representing their role as a presiding authority in a courtroom.

Usage Context

Used to denote legal matters, court proceedings, or moments where someone is making a final ruling or decision. It is frequently sent during discussions about fairness or legal drama, often accompanied by the scales of justice โš–๏ธ or a gavel ๐Ÿ”จ.

History

The judge emoji was first added to the Unicode standard in 2016 as part of Emoji 3.0. The ability to modify the skin tone was introduced to ensure that digital representations of professional roles reflected a more diverse global population within workplace and social communication.
